Uttar Pradesh Trade Show To Showcase State’s Cultural Diversity
Uttar Pradesh will hold many cultural performances during its International Trade Show.
The show will run from September 25 to 29.
Visitors will see music, dances and folk traditions from different parts of the state.
Artists will perform Kathak, Bhojpuri songs, folk dances and devotional music.
There will also be classical performances on instruments such as the sitar and pakhawaj.
Some programmes will highlight regional traditions such as Tharu dance and Alha singing.
The events will take place alongside business and trade activities.
Organisers hope guests from India and other countries learn more about Uttar Pradesh’s culture.
The UP International Trade Show will host cultural programmes from September 25 to 29.
The events will feature folk arts, classical music, dance, devotional singing and regional traditions.
Performances will represent regions including Kashi, Mathura, Vrindavan, Bundelkhand, Awadh, Purvanchal and the Terai.
Scheduled highlights include Kathak, Bhojpuri folk music, Tharu tribal dance, Alha singing, Sufi music and a sitar recital.
The programme aims to present Uttar Pradesh’s cultural, industrial, trade and tourism identity to visitors from India and abroad.
